This time with the idea to provide simply a complete and reliable list of the RCRs (Lidar and not Lidar) we have in the game we love.
I know there're already a bunch of these lists, but probably this can be in any case useful for someone, for two main reasons :
1) I'm checking every course with a satellite map to give the chance to players and/or schedulers, to know what they're the courses actually accurate enough to be considered "real" RCRs and then to decide accordingly what course to play, knowing what it can offer in terms of accuracy.
2) The list has already more or less 400 courses (almost 200 already verified, i'm still working to verify all of them..but they're a lot!!), plus 50-60 courses created for Simulator Only, just to know they exists, if you find these courses on some other list, or if you use also simulator. - Some course normally considered a RCR, in this list will be listed as a RL (Real Lookalike). I beg you to consider that this is not an offence or a way to "belittle" a course. It means only that the course is not so accurate to be considered exactly a RCR. They're a lot of courses that offers a great atmosphere and the flow of the Real course, but possibly the shape of fairways, greens, bunkers or water hazards are not so accurate. It happens for a good number of courses but, again, is not a reason to consider these courses declassified in some way. Conversely, this is probably the best way i could ever find to recognize some prize for those guys who have the unbelievable patience to create a course absolutely perfectly shaped in everything. And they are a lot, even without the Lidar.
- Please also consider that, to be considered a RL in this list, a course needs to fit at least two of these three parameters, compared with the IRL course, otherwise they are listed as FL (Fictional Lookalike) :
1) correct total par.
2) correct order of holes in the scorecard.
3) correct routing of the course.
